Slope Measurement
The rate at which a line or curve inclines or declines, indicating the relationship between changes in variables on a graph.
Price Elasticity
A measure of how much the quantity demanded of a good responds to a change in the price of that good, often influencing pricing strategies.
Demand Curve
A graphical representation of the relationship between the price of a good and the quantity demanded by consumers.
Infinity
A concept in mathematics and physics that refers to a quantity without bound or end.
